OFF TO THE OUA FINAL FOUR
So
the regular season is over (15-4), the first round of the playoffs
has finished off (win vs York) and now what sits in front of the
Gee-Gees Volleyball Team is the OUA Final Four Tournament and
a chance for one team to head to Calgary (March 1 – 4) for
the National Championship Tournament to represent the OUA.

The
OUA Final Four is set for the University of Toronto (Feb 24 &
25)
*All games to be played in main sports gym at U of T (89 Harbord
Street)
Semi-final
#1 – Friday, Feb. 24 – 6:00 pm - Toronto vs Laurier
Semi-final #2 – Friday, Feb. 25 – 8:00 pm - OTTAWA
vs Windsor
Bronze
Medal Game – Saturday, Feb. 25 – 6:00 pm – Losers
of semi-finals
Gold Medal Game – Saturday, Feb. 25 – 8:00
pm - Winners of semi-finals
